Constellation Residences at Northstar

Exciting New Opportunity to Own at Northstar! The Constellation Residences at Northstar are Lake Tahoe’s only truly ski in/ski out mid mountain resort residences and are soon becoming available for reservations!

These spectacular residences are completed and fully furnished.  Homeowners have access to a complete bundle of services and amenities, many of which are just steps away at the renowned Ritz-Carlton Hotel & Resort at Northstar. Residents here enjoy the very best of luxury living at a more affordable cost.

With the popular two-bedroom Residences well-priced from the low- $900,000’s to the sprawling four-bedroom residences, Constellation Residences at Northstar offers a range of residences to satisfy today’s sophisticated buyer.

Martis Camp Real Estate Update 2011

martis camp real estate2011 was a great year for Martis Camp! We just received this Martis Camp update as we come to a close for 2011 and start the new year of 2012. Exciting new things coming to Martis Camp this year!

With the new year in full swing, 2011 gave us a great deal to celebrate at Martis Camp.

The year’s hallmark was no doubt the July 1 opening of the Camp Lodge. Anchored by the Camp Lodge, DMB Highlands Group has now spent a total of $90 million in amenities at Martis Camp, once again demonstrating their unwavering commitment to redefining the way our families experience Tahoe.

This investment inspired great confidence, excitement and eagerness–the fruits of which were evidenced as we welcomed nearly 100 new families to Martis Camp. Through their purchase of 83 homesites, 11 home/lot packages and 5 custom homes totaling approximately $90.2 million in sales, Martis Camp was the overwhelming choice for families committed to the vision of a surpassing Tahoe retreat.

The year’s momentum was no less evident in the eagerness of our families to establish their Martis Camp homes. With 50 homes completed, another 84 under construction, 60 in the design review process along with 48 new starts in 2011, this was a landmark year for our new home construction-reflecting the deep sense of community and permanence at Martis Camp.

We would be remiss if we failed to also celebrate those who made so many 2011 highlights worth remembering–everyone at the Martis Camp Club. From countless dining experiences and unforgettable social events, to the summer camp for kids, folk school classes and unsurpassed golf and ski experiences, the dedicated Ambassadors at the Martis Camp club worked tirelessly and cheerfully to make 2011 a truly sterling year!

As we conclude a superlative 2011, we look forward to an equally exciting 2012.

The Tennis Park and Pavilion with two clay courts and two hard surface courts is scheduled to open in the late Fall of 2012. The 8,000 square-foot ski lodge is also scheduled for completion this year, which will find families next ski season enjoying breakfast, lunch and vibrant Après-ski experiences at the base of Lookout Mountain–in addition to Martis Camp’s countless other opportunities for recreation, solitude and building enduring memories.

Tahoe Home Sales Stats Holding Steady

 Zephyr Cove, Nev. (Jan. 5, 2012) – Year-end home sales at Lake Tahoe are holding steady compared to 2010 with some indicators on the rise, according to a quarterly report released by Lake Tahoe-based real estate firm Chase International, which notes a one-percent increase in units sold around the lake.

The National Association of Realtors recently reported that existing home sales rose again in November and remain above a year ago, and the latest Tahoe housing market sales figures concur with this national trend.  In fact, while real estate sales and prices took a slight dip around the lake overall, the East Shore market segment saw a one-percent increase in median home price ($575,000) and a 35-percent jump in average price ($1,286,924). Volume sold on the East Shore was up 26 percent, while the number of units was down seven percent.

Although the number of units sold is up slightly, the median price of a home in Lake Tahoe is down thirteen percent to $365,000 from 2010’s year-end numbers. The average home price fell 14 percent to $607,683.

“High end home sales on the East Shore helped buoy the Lake Tahoe market,” said Susan Lowe, corporate vice president for Chase International. “It definitely is still a buyers’ market as average and median prices have continued to fall but with units sold rising we believe the market is strengthening.”

Truckee reflects this same trend, seeing a two-percent increase in units sold and a 17-percent rise in units sold for less than a million. The median price of a home in Truckee is $438,166 (down 10 percent) and the average price is $562,811 (also down 10 percent).

The condominium market around Lake Tahoe experienced a six-percent decline over 2010 in units sold.  However, for units sold for more than $500,000, a notable 29 percent jump occurred. Tahoe City experienced the most pronounced increase in sales over 2010 sales figures, with a three-percent rise in units sold and up 50-percent in units sold for over $500,000.  South Lake Tahoe saw a 21-percent increase in overall volume sold, with median and average prices rising 14 and 69 percent, respectively. The median price of a condo in Lake Tahoe is $262,000 (down eight percent) and the average price is $348,868 (down 12 percent).
